If you can't see it from a two or three feet away I wouldn't worry about it.
Six weeks isn't very long for a new tank to mature so it might just go away on it's own.
Are you running a skimmer? A skimmer should pull some of it out.
I have to assume that since this is posted on the reef forum that the tank will be a reef, so I will add that as the tank matures you will have floaties come and go as pods multiply and other critters spawn and grow in the tank, Think of it as coral food.

You could try to run a micron filter now but I don't recomend it when the tank has corals in it for the same reason as stated above, it's good for the corals.
